COURSE TITLE

TAX IMPLICATIONS OF BUYING AND SELLING BUSINESSES

DATE 11th November 2008
VENUE
SPEAKER Giles Mooney
COURSE CODE NO11A8
COURSE FEE £85+VAT. (Click here for information on the Flexiticket discount scheme - fees as low as £38+VAT per place)
TIMING
Registration Course starts Coffee Course ends
09:00 09:30 11:00 12:30
OBJECTIVES

The course will consider the tax consequences of the alternatives available to individuals and groups buying and selling unquoted companies and will identify the efficient options to be pursued in differing circumstances.

WHO SHOULD ATTEND?

General practitioners who need to appreciate the implications of commercial transactions, actual or intended.

TOPICS

 

Introduction

  • Buyer and seller
  • When tax planning is needed
  • Effect of anti avoidance rules
  • Clearances

Assets or shares?

  • Advantages of assets
  • Advantages of shares
  • Using hive downs

Tax effects on valuation

  • Accounting policies
  • VAT consequences

Consideration for sale

  • Shares or cash
  • Earn outs
  • Loan notes
  • Purchase of own shares
  • Payments to directors
  • Pension arrangements

Warranties and indemnities

  • Tax consequences of each
  • What to include

Group tax consequences for buyer and seller

  • Loss reliefs
  • Capital gains
